Assets beyond income: NAB approves inquiry against Shehbaz Sharif
LAHORE: (DNA) – The National Accountability Bureau (NAB) has launched another investigation against Pakistan Muslim League-Nawaz (PML-N) president and former chief minister of Punjab Shahbaz Sharif to detect his ‘illegal’ assets.
According to details, the bureau will ask another 10-day physical remand of PML-N president from accountability court on October 29.
On the other hand, NAB has claimed to have found more evidence against Shehbaz Sharif in Ashiana Housing scandal.
The anti-corruption watchdog has accused Shehbaz of misusing the authorities of Punjab Land Development Company’s (PLDC) board of directors.
While recording the statements, former officials of the company revealed that contracts were awarded to the favorite firm after cancelation on the directives of then Punjab Chief Minister Shehbaz Sharif.
